Major new store opens on Clumber Street in Nottingham

A major high street retailer has opened on one of Nottingham's busiest shopping streets after closing its store on Low Pavement Street where it had been for 13 years. Paperchase has opened its brand new location on Clumber Street.

The store took just weeks to move from its previous location and is now fully kitted out with new signage and displays. Paperchase offers design-led cards, wraps, stationery and gifts along with craft supplies. it was one of the biggest high street retailers to be based in Low Pavement which is undergoing a transformation following several closures on the street including Whistles and Juni Gin Bar during Covid.

There had been fears Paperchase could close following the business collapse into administration in May 2021. The company was taken over and continued trading, saving 1,000 jobs across the brand. It joins several other high-profile brands on the street including Lush, Tag Heuer and Superdrug.

Clumber Street was one dubbed 'one of the busiest streets in Europe'. The street reportedly had an annual footfall of 19.8 million a year.
